IEC 60268-7:2025
Sound system equipment - Part 7: Headphones and earphones

IEC 60268-7:2025 provides the technical reference for sound system equipment focused on headphones and earphones. It is relevant to organizations that need a documented basis for product evaluation, test planning, procurement review, and conformity assessment.
